A residential floor refers to the all square footage of the living area within the perimeter of a residential structure. An entire residential floor, similarly, includes the entire leasable area on the second or higher floors of a residential building that is rented or sold as a single unit of property. Providing several significant advantages, entire residential floors are among the most popular properties to buy and rent in Dubai.

Cost Considerations: Rent, Purchase, and Maintenance
Your budget determines many factors regarding a residential floor to buy or rent, including space and location. Get your financial issues in order and check the cost/rent of the property and any additional fees like registration fees, air conditioning fees, and maintenance fees. Notice that there can be hidden costs, such as DEWA bills when buying or renting a residential floor in Dubai. Thus, it will be helpful to consult advisors to check all the information regarding mortgage terms as well as other possible financing options.

Legal and Contractual Factors
Both the rental and sale process for a residential floor in Dubai must be carried out through a validated real estate broker or agent to comply with Dubai’s laws and regulations. It helps to protect both parties of a contract, whether a rental or purchase contract, and clarify terms regarding deposits, DEWA and registration fees, mortgage, amenities, and maintenance. Remember that a residential contract, either rental or purchase, is a mandatory agreement that must be followed after being signed. Thus, make sure you read the contract and understand the entire section before signing it.

What’s the Average Cost of Renting or Buying a Residential Floor?
The cost of renting or buying a residential floor in Dubai largely depends on a lot of factors such as location, floor, number of bedrooms, amenities, etc. The average cost of renting a residential floor in Dubai Marina and Palm Jumeirah, for example, ranges between AED 66,000 to AED 200,000 per year. The average rental cost in Business Bay and Downtown Dubai could start at AED 150,000 per year. The average sale price of a residential floor in theaforementioned areas in Dubai also follows features such as space and location. The prices may start at AED 1,500,000 in Dubai land and reach AED 50,000,000 in Dubai Marina.

Can I customize the Space?
No structural modifications are ever allowed on a residential floor in Dubai. However, it is very common to customize the interior of a residential floor, including repainting, changing decoration and cabinets, or redoing the flooring.
